Output f1b6bb609d3bb53be352e5245269065a3fade17a1f9d53491444ef113560e971:6

value
2827515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0c5e808d6554d9eff80bdba57d81e93af2641d OP_EQUAL
address
3G6hWGzQiJia3trJvWnsMstZDc7MQF6zCF
transaction
f1b6bb609d3bb53be352e5245269065a3fade17a1f9d53491444ef113560e971
confirmations
383721
spent
true